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
Comfort level and material
Look for mats with a thick, high-density foam core (0.75–1 inch or more) to cushion feet and reduce fatigue. Memory foam and multilayer constructions tend to offer better long-term comfort. Consider the surface material: PU leather or waterproof, stain-resistant tops are easier to clean and maintain, especially in kitchens or workshops.
Surface grip and durability
A non-slip top helps prevent shifting on smooth floors. A textured bottom or anti-slip backing adds stability in high-traffic areas. For industrial spaces, consider water resistance and puncture resistance to ensure longevity despite spills and heavy use.
Size and suitability for space
Mats come in a range of sizes. Larger mats provide more foot room but require more floor space. Compact or modular mats can fit smaller desks or workstations. For rolling desks or mobile setups, portable designs with handles or wheels can be advantageous.
Portability and storage
Portability features like built-in handles, light weights, and wheels improve convenience for multi-use areas. If you frequently move between rooms or need temporary standing setups, a lightweight or foldable option is beneficial.
Maintenance and cleaning
Choose mats with easy-clean surfaces, especially in kitchens or garages. Waterproof or oil-resistant tops simplify cleanup. Regularly inspect the edges for wear to prevent tripping hazards.
Allergy and health considerations
People with sensitive skin or allergies may prefer mats with hypoallergenic materials and minimal chemical odor. Look for products with certifications or stated material safety features if this is a priority.
